要查看Python中的函数帮助菜单,可以使用help()函数、dir()函数、文档字符串、在线文档等方法。以下是详细描述和使用这些方法的技巧:
一、help()函数
使用help()函数是获取Python函数帮助信息最直接的方法之一。可以在交互式解释器中直接使用help()函数查询函数的帮助信息。例如,要查看内置函数len()的帮助信息,可以输入help(len)
,就会显示该函数的详细说明,包括函数的描述、参数和用法。
使用help()函数查看帮助
help()函数是Python内置的获取帮助信息的函数,可以用于查看函数、模块、类、方法等的帮助文档。它会显示函数的描述、参数、返回值以及其他有用的信息。
# 查看len()函数的帮助信息
help(len)
查看自定义函数的帮助信息
def my_function(param1, param2):
"""
这是一个示例函数。
参数:
param1 - 第一个参数
param2 - 第二个参数
返回值:
返回两个参数的和
"""
return param1 + param2
help(my_function)
在上面的示例中,使用help()函数可以查看len()和自定义函数my_function的帮助信息。这对于理解函数的功能和用法非常有帮助。
二、dir()函数
使用dir()函数可以列出某个模块或对象的所有属性和方法。虽然dir()函数不会提供详细的帮助信息,但它可以帮助你快速了解某个模块或对象中可用的函数和属性。例如,使用dir(str)
可以列出字符串对象的所有方法和属性。
使用dir()函数列出属性和方法
dir()函数用于列出对象的所有属性和方法,可以帮助你快速了解对象的可用功能。虽然它不会提供详细的帮助信息,但它可以作为获取帮助文档的第一步。
# 查看字符串对象的所有属性和方法
print(dir(str))
查看自定义模块的所有属性和方法
import math
print(dir(math))
在上面的示例中,使用dir()函数列出了字符串对象str和数学模块math的所有属性和方法。这对于了解对象的功能非常有用。
三、文档字符串
文档字符串(docstring)是一种嵌入在代码中的文本,用于描述模块、类或函数的功能。可以通过访问函数的__doc__
属性来查看函数的文档字符串。例如,print(len.__doc__)
可以显示len()函数的文档字符串。文档字符串通常包含函数的描述、参数说明和返回值信息。
查看文档字符串
文档字符串(docstring)是一种嵌入在代码中的文本,用于描述模块、类或函数的功能。可以通过访问函数的__doc__属性来查看函数的文档字符串。
# 查看len()函数的文档字符串
print(len.__doc__)
查看自定义函数的文档字符串
def my_function(param1, param2):
"""
这是一个示例函数。
参数:
param1 - 第一个参数
param2 - 第二个参数
返回值:
返回两个参数的和
"""
return param1 + param2
print(my_function.__doc__)
在上面的示例中,使用__doc__属性可以查看len()和自定义函数my_function的文档字符串。文档字符串通常包含函数的描述、参数说明和返回值信息。
四、在线文档
Python的官方网站提供了详细的在线文档,可以通过访问 Python文档 获取最新的函数、模块和库的帮助信息。这些文档是由Python开发者和社区成员编写的,内容详尽,涵盖了Python的各个方面。
查阅在线文档
Python的官方网站提供了详细的在线文档,可以通过访问 Python文档 获取最新的函数、模块和库的帮助信息。这些文档是由Python开发者和社区成员编写的,内容详尽,涵盖了Python的各个方面。
在在线文档中,可以使用搜索功能快速找到所需的帮助信息。此外,在线文档还提供了丰富的示例代码和教程,帮助你更好地理解和使用Python。
五、集成开发环境(IDE)
很多集成开发环境(IDE)也提供了查看函数帮助信息的功能。例如,PyCharm、VSCode等IDE通常会在你输入函数名时自动显示该函数的帮助信息。如果没有自动显示,可以通过快捷键或菜单选项手动查看帮助信息。
使用IDE查看帮助信息
现代的集成开发环境(IDE)通常提供了查看函数帮助信息的功能。例如,PyCharm、VSCode等IDE通常会在你输入函数名时自动显示该函数的帮助信息。如果没有自动显示,可以通过快捷键或菜单选项手动查看帮助信息。
在使用IDE时,建议充分利用这些功能,以提高编程效率和代码质量。
总结:
通过help()函数、dir()函数、文档字符串、在线文档和IDE等方法,可以方便地查看Python函数的帮助信息。这些方法各有优缺点,可以根据实际需要选择使用。无论是学习新函数、调试代码还是编写文档,了解和使用这些方法都能极大地提高编程效率。
相关问答FAQs:
如何在Python中查看函数的详细文档?
在Python中,可以使用内置的help()
函数来查看任何函数的详细文档。只需在交互式环境中输入help(函数名)
,系统会显示该函数的文档字符串,提供关于其用法、参数和返回值的详细信息。这种方式非常适合快速查阅不熟悉的函数。
有没有其他方式可以获取Python函数的帮助信息?
除了help()
函数外,还可以使用.__doc__
属性来查看函数的文档字符串。例如,输入函数名.__doc__
可以直接获取函数的说明。这个方法非常直接,适合想要快速查看特定函数的用户。
在使用Python IDE时,如何快速访问函数的帮助信息?
许多Python集成开发环境(IDE)如PyCharm、VSCode等,都提供了函数的自动补全和文档查看功能。通常,您只需将光标放在函数名上,使用特定的快捷键(如Ctrl
+ Q
或F1
),即可弹出该函数的文档。这种方法便于在编写代码时随时查阅所需的信息。